Immune approaches beyond traditional immune checkpoint inhibitors for advanced renal cell carcinoma

Volume 19, Issue 3, December 2023 .
Source: Human Vaccines and Immunotherapeutics - Category: Allergy & Immunology Authors: Source Type: research